Brunel has an exciting job opportunity for a Project Engineering Manager supporting our client who are a large global mining company. This contractor position will be in New Orleans, Louisiana, working four weeks in New Orleans and one week at home, accommodations and transport provided.

What are you going to do

Manage engineering design, procurement, and construction activities within the mining company. Engineering Manager will generally be responsible for projects in the $500 million to multi-billion dollar projects. Provide technical advice and guidance for all phases of assigned large/complex engineering projects, programs and contracts, ensuring the successful conclusion of all phases within an appropriate time and at appropriate cost.

Essential skills and knowledge 

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or related engineering discipline from an accredited curriculum and ten (10) years related experience and familiarity with processes, systems, and terminology in project, engineering and construction management, OR
  • Master's degree in Engineering or related engineering discipline from an accredited curriculum and eight (8) years related experience and familiarity with processes, systems, and terminology in project management, engineering, and construction.

    Language Skills, Certifications and/or Training

  • Fluency in English
  • Broad knowledge of the principles and practices of mechanical engineering
  • Ability to research and analyze information of considerable difficulty and draw valid conclusions
  • Skill in effective communication, both verbal and written, including the ability to actively listen and to adapt behavior and communication style based upon the audience
  • Ability to develop and maintain awareness of occupational hazards and safety precautions
  • Skill in following safety practices, and recognizing, controlling and/or eliminating hazards Ability to build trust and credibility with employees/peers and establish common goals and expectations
  • Strong analytical skills
